Octobers Very Own (OVO):

Founded by global music icon Drake, OVO is more than just a clothing brand; it’s an extension of his persona. With its sleek designs, owl emblem, and monochromatic palettes, OVO embodies a lifestyle that marries sophistication with urban cool. From its inception, OVO has cultivated a deep connection with its audience by blending music, culture, and fashion seamlessly. The brand’s collaborations with luxury labels and limited-edition releases have propelled it to the pinnacle of streetwear, making it a staple for those who value understated yet impactful fashion.


The Essence of Corteiz: Redefining Streetwear Culture

Corteiz, on the other hand, is the unapologetic disruptor. Emerging from London’s vibrant streetwear scene, it challenges norms with bold designs and a no-holds-barred attitude. Known for its rebellious ethos, the brand thrives on exclusivity and grassroots marketing, fostering a strong sense of community among its followers. Corteiz’s designs are a canvas for self-expression, often featuring provocative slogans and unconventional graphics. Its rapid rise to prominence reflects a yearning for authenticity in a world increasingly saturated with mass-produced trends.


Signature Styles and Designs:

OVO leans towards minimalism, favoring clean lines, neutral tones, and the iconic owl motif—a symbol of wisdom and mystery. In contrast, Corteiz embraces maximalism, with vibrant patterns, oversized silhouettes, and edgy graphics that demand attention. While OVO’s aesthetic appeals to those seeking refined casual wear, corteiz hoodie resonates with individuals who prefer a bolder, more rebellious style. Both brands, however, share an underlying commitment to quality, ensuring that their pieces are as durable as they are stylish.

The Role of Exclusivity in Branding:

Exclusivity is the lifeblood of both OVO and Corteiz. Limited-edition releases and surprise drops create an air of scarcity, fueling demand and solidifying their status as must-have brands. For OVO, exclusivity aligns with its polished image, while for Corteiz, it underscores its anti-establishment ethos. This deliberate strategy not only drives sales but also cultivates a sense of belonging among their audiences—a badge of honor for those who manage to snag their coveted pieces.
